Output 68677de828b830617714b3c594a12ba7db302862cdb97c21be42a9f41bf8ce05:0

value
500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0cf7bc00b5e2460d602c7a23cd4bece62b78e74a OP_EQUAL
address
32saojSkWu9fw72VNdc8yWTr37ALwFgjhp
transaction
68677de828b830617714b3c594a12ba7db302862cdb97c21be42a9f41bf8ce05
spent
true